Start doing breast-firming exercises as soon as possible

A woman’s body undergoes a series of significant changes at every stage of life, which take their toll on the condition of her breasts. Some women are naturally blessed with firm breasts, so gravity and the passage of time are relatively kind to them. The turning point often comes during pregnancy or after breastfeeding has ended. During this period, the breasts undergo a particularly gruelling ordeal, which very often leads to permanent changes.

Then, of course, there is also a large group of women whose breasts begin to sag at a young age due to external or internal factors.

6 main causes of sagging breasts

  1. Genetic predisposition
  2. Hormonal changes
  3. Breastfeeding
  4. Unhealthy lifestyle (being overweight, obesity, smoking, excessive sun exposure, etc.),
  5. Significant weight loss
  6. The ageing process

If you want to maintain your skin’s elasticity, eat a healthy diet and avoid smoking. The skin around the breasts is very delicate, so protect it from direct sunlight or use creams with a high SPF.

The best exercises for firming women’s breasts

Don’t forget to warm up before every workout. The ideal warm-up involves raising and lowering your arms in combination with arm swings.

  • The plank is one of the most effective exercises. It helps strengthen practically your whole body. However, holding this position is by no means easy. Your elbows should be directly beneath your shoulders. Your wrists should be in line with your elbows. Your head should be an extension of your spine. Your spine must not sag. Your whole body should be tense. Hold this position for as long as possible. Then rest and repeat at least three times. After a while, you can try more challenging variations of the plank, such as the side plank.
  • Walking up stairs with your hands behind your head is another simple but highly effective way to strengthen your chest muscles. As part of this single exercise, you’ll also strengthen your upper body (glutes, thighs and calves). Walking up the stairs sideways is also effective.
  • The ‘prayer’ is a type of exercise you can do either standing or sitting. Stand or sit up straight and press your palms together as if you were praying. Press your palms together for at least 10 seconds, then release. Repeat this several times in a row. The advantage of this simple exercise is that you can do it practically anywhere.
  • Push-ups are a classic exercise that nobody really likes, but they work perfectly. Just as with the plank, it’s important to perform them correctly. You don’t have to do 50 push-ups; the main thing is that you do them properly. You can choose either the men’s or women’s version.

Men also seek out exercises to firm up their chests

Sagging breasts can also be a concern for men. This may be caused by gynaecomastia. This is a non-cancerous enlargement of the mammary gland in men. At certain stages, it is a completely natural phenomenon that resolves itself. However, if it persists or the enlargement is asymmetrical, hormone treatment is necessary. Another option is plastic surgery. During the procedure, the surgeon may perform liposuction, remove excess glandular tissue, or carry out a combination of both.
